Endorsement-in-blank

noun
1.
an endorsement on a check or note naming no payee, and therefore payable to bearer.
noun
1.
an endorsement on a bill of exchange, cheque, etc, naming no payee and thus making the endorsed sum payable to the bearer Also called endorsement in blank
